Rays' Success and the Upcoming Sports Complex in Tampa
The Tampa Bay Rays are celebrating a significant milestone with the announcement of a new ballpark that will ensure their presence in the Tampa Bay area for the foreseeable future. Set to be constructed across from Raymond James Stadium, this development will transform the area into a bustling sports complex. The Rays, currently leading by 4.5 games and having already secured 81 wins against a preseason expectation of 75, are on track to potentially finish the season with 98 wins. This performance positions them as strong contenders for the postseason and possibly even the World Series.
